Trademark violations alleged by NASCAR in suit targeting counterfeit merch sellers

By Shirley Henderson

July 31, 2026, 11:18 am CDT

The NASCAR Cup Series Brickyard 400 at the Indianapolis Motor Speedway on July 26, 2026, in Indianapolis. (Photo by Justin Casterline/Getty Images)

Racing giant NASCAR filed a trademark infringement lawsuit Monday against undisclosed sellers of unauthorized merchandise.

The motorsport mammoth alleges in the suit that an undisclosed number of companies have infringed on its trademarks in violation of the Lanham Act, the federal statute governing trademark law, by selling unauthorized merchandise through fake e-commerce storefronts.

NASCAR identifies the unidentified defendants as “individuals, corporations, limited liability companies, partnerships and unincorporated associations,” according to coverage by Courthouse News Service.

Concluding its own investigation, NASCAR said it found evidence of an illegal counterfeiting and infringement scheme. It accuses the defendants of blurring its trademarks on their products and creating “numerous” aliases to evade the U.S. Department of Homeland Security.
